Understanding Product Liability Claims and Why They Matter

When a defective product causes harm, the legal system can help injured people pursue comp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and related expenses. A product liability case often centers on whether a manufacturer, distributor, retailer, or other party failed to keep products reasonably safe. These claims may Product liability lawyer involve design defects, manufacturing defects, or marketing and warning problems that leave consumers without adequate safety information. The goal is not only to address the harm an individual experienced, but also to encourage stronger quality controls and safer product standards.

Injury outcomes can be complicated because the facts behind a defect may be spread across multiple parties and documents. Insurance companies may also dispute causation, argue the product was misused, or claim the harm was caused by something other than the product itself. Another benefit is strategic investigation and expert coordination. Product cases frequently require technical analysis from professionals who can test the product, review manufacturing processes, or explain how a design flaw increases risk. An can also help identify every responsible party, including component suppliers and distributors, not just the brand name on the packaging. That expanded view can improve settlement leverage because it shows the claim is supported by a thorough understanding of how the defect occurred and who should bear responsibility.

How the Legal Process Supports Compensation-First Decisions

A benefits-led representation emphasizes milestones that move the case toward measurable results. After initial consultation, the legal team typically evaluates the facts, reviews medical records, and estimates the value of damages based on documented losses. This may include reimbursement for hospital care, diagnostic testing, follow-up treatment, and future care needs when injuries cause long-term limitations. A well-prepared case can also account for non-economic impacts like scarring, diminished quality of life, and ongoing pain.

During case development, counsel often manages communication with insurance companies to prevent statements from being misused or taken out of context. Claims can be delayed or undervalued when parties do not have the proper documentation, so attorneys focus on building a complete evidence record. Settlement discussions may include negotiations around medical expenses, wage impacts, and other measurable damages, and sometimes require filing suit to protect rights.
